Разъединение веток в системе контроля версий (СКВ) – важная операция, позволяющая разделить независимые линии разработки и изменений. Это полезно в ситуациях, когда необходимо отделить основную ветку от экспериментальной, исправить ошибки или создать параллельную версию программного проекта.
В этом подробном руководстве мы рассмотрим как разъединить две ветки в популярных СКВ: Git и SVN.
В Git, разъединение веток происходит с использованием команды «git branch», позволяющей создать новую ветку на основе существующей. После создания новой ветки, вы можете внести необходимые изменения в каждую из них независимо, не влияя на другую. Это полезно, когда вы хотите внести экспериментальные изменения или разработать новую функцию, не рискуя повредить основную ветку.
В SVN, разъединение веток происходит путем копирования одной ветки в другую и дальнейшей редакции каждой из них независимо. Для этого используется команда «svn copy», которая позволяет создавать копии веток или директорий. После создания копии, вы можете сделать необходимые изменения в каждой ветке независимо от другой. Это полезно при разработке различных версий продукта или в случае необходимости отделить параллельные линии разработки.